IntegrityWatcher

File Integrity Monitoring Project with Email Alerts

IntegrityWatcher is a Python-based solution designed for robust file integrity monitoring within a specified directory. This project empowers users to establish a secure baseline of file hashes, enabling continuous vigilance for unauthorized changes or new file creations. Notably, it includes features for SMTP email alerts and the ability to run as an executable on different systems.

Project Overview

Key Features

  • Baseline Creation: Compute SHA-512 hashes for files in the "Files" directory to establish a secure foundation.
  • Continuous Monitoring: Vigilantly observe files for changes, new additions, or deletions.
  • Security Breach Detection: Swiftly identify potential security breaches or unauthorized file modifications.
  • SMTP Email Alerts: Receive notifications via email for any unauthorized changes or new file additions.
  • Executable Usage: Convert the script to an executable for seamless deployment on various systems.

Key Components

  1. calculate_file_hash(filepath): Compute the SHA-512 hash of a file.
  2. erase_baseline_if_already_exists(): Safeguard to erase an existing baseline for a fresh start.
  3. log_change(action, file_path, username): Log changes made to files, including action type, file path, and the user responsible.
  4. notify_server_mailtrap(action, file_path, username): Send email alerts using the Mailtrap SMTP server to notify about file changes.
  5. get_username(): Retrieve the system user's username running the script.

Usage

  1. Choose 'A' to create a new baseline or 'B' to begin monitoring with an existing one.

  2. Configure SMTP settings in config.py for email alerts.

  3. Run the script in your preferred environment:

    python fileintegerity.py
